Sundowner's syndrome or sundowning is a condition frequently seen in patients with organic mental disorders. Sundowning can best be described as:
 
  A) Compulsion to watch the sun set
  B) Sleeping 12 hours per day
  C) Reversing day and night behavior (sleeping during the day and staying awake during the night)
  D) Staying awake for several days at a time

Ether was used widely for surgeries but became less popular because of its flammability and its tendency to cause vomiting. In England, it was quickly replaced by chloroform, but this agent caused many deaths and lost popularity.
